Emily Janoski-Haehlen joined the Akron Law faculty in 2017 and became the law school’s first female dean in 2022. Her current research explores social media law, cryptocurrency, cybersecurity, privacy, legal research instruction strategies, and technology in the practice of law. Prior to joining Akron Law, Dean Janoski-Haehlen served as Associate Dean of the Law Library at Valparaiso University Law School and as a faculty member and librarian at Northern Kentucky University, Chase College of Law.

Dean Janoski-Haehlen is a member of the Kentucky Bar, the American Association of Law Libraries, Ohio Regional Association of Law Libraries, and she serves on accreditation teams for the American Bar Association. She earned her B.S. in History from the University of Kentucky, her M.S. in Library Science from the University of Kentucky and her J.D. from Northern Kentucky University.
